ISD 199 recognizes paraprofessionals, board members complete MSBA training; membership reports given
Summary
The board recognized paraprofessionals for Paraprofessional Recognition Week and celebrated two board members’ completion of MSBA Learning to Lead training. Membership reports noted AMSD, BEST Foundation and MSBA meetings.

Board Chair Carrie Lounsberry recognized Board Clerk Shana Dukes and Board Member Darcie Pierson for completing all four phases of the Minnesota School Boards Association 'Learning to Lead' training. Directors Abel Riodique and Megan Blazek recognized paraprofessionals across the district for Paraprofessional Recognition Week and thanked them for their dedication and support of students.
Membership reports included: AMSD met Jan. 9 with routine business and an Executive Committee election; the Inver Grove Heights B.E.S.T. Foundation met Jan. 25 to review scholarships for 2026; and several board members attended the MSBA Leadership Conference Jan. 16–17, which focused on "Inspiring Connection, Teamwork, and Courage." Board Member Niemioja also noted his election onto the MSBA board.
